Devin is the unofficial owner of Midstellar Market, who happens to take his job a bit too seriously.
Background:
Devin is a proud self-sufficient store manager of Midstellar Market. Before he became their #1 store manager, he lived all his life in The Castle of Bloodroot while pursuing his love for journalism. Unfortunately, his family was strongly against his passion for journalism and refused to get involved with his future decisions. Despite this, Devin successfully landed an apprenticeship for the most well-known newspaper in The Ghostly, The Midwalk Journal, now proudly known as The Ghostly Fables. Devin quickly worked his way up the work ladder. Sadly after his final promotion as editor-in-chief, many had issues with his lack of credentials and questioned his capabilities and many arguments broke out within the workplace. After a particularly intense argument that turned violent and physical, everyone was sent home once the CEO heard the commotion. The very next day the whole building of The Midwalk Journal completely disappeared and Devin and his former coworkers were left jobless.
Because of his sudden employment change, Devin decided to move out of the fast-paced neighborhood of The Castle of Bloodroot and into the calm village of Yolkytown. Glady Devin was able to find a place to live on his first day! He took the vacant room above the peculiar shop named Midstellar Market, in exchange for cleaning after-hours every day. Devin quickly discovered the enjoyment he felt when helping around the shop, despite the owner's strange lurking presence. As business slowly picked up in Midstellar Market, Devin was offered an official position as the shop assistant while the owner's infamous disappearances began. By the time the odd owner eventually disappeared completely, Devin was promoted to shop manager. During his off-duty days, Devin can be found sitting by the window above the shop smoking and invested completely in a book during the dark of night.
Personality:
Devin is a snarky and analytical person. Knowing his complicated family life and work background, he rather sits back and sips a glass of fine wine before acting on his feelings. Devin is a very hardworking and optimistic person in secret. Devin's current goal is to see Midstellar Market reach its full potential, despite the shop's difficult relationship with the people of Yolkytown. Because of this clear vision, Devin holds a firm and strict control over those who work in the shop-.
Fashion Sense:
Devin's fashion sense can be described as thick and warm. Despite the soft spring-like weather in Yolkytown, he has not fully adapted from his Castle of Bloodroot-attire. Devin enjoys warm clothing, with his signature dark gray turtleneck and form-fitting, pressed black slacks. He prefers to stick to dark colores, in contrast to the bright or playful patterns that are commonly found among the folks of Yolkytown.
Platonic & Romantic Relationships:
Playing kindly with others does not come easy for Devin. He struggles with opening up to others, acts very awkwardly when trying to converse, and acts harshly without realizing it. Because of this, Devin tends to sticks to himself. Despite this, Devin sometimes catches himself shamefully trying to connect with his subordinates, Shoes, and Lee. To prevent this, he comforts himself within the written words that live among his tiny library above the shop.
Before he started his promotional climb in The Midwalk Journal, Devin was actually quite popular amongst his acquaintances for his work ethic and looks. He had gone on a few first dates out of curiosity but never went further than that. Currently, Devin isn't looking for more than his exciting relationship with Midstellar Market but is open to a passionate connection with others if the opportunity arises.
